CIHR HEAD TO ANSWER FOR PRE-EMPTING PARLIAMENT WITH FUNDING DECISIONS

McLellan Blasted for "fraud, a sham and a waste of taxpayers' money"

OTTAWA, April 15, 2002 (LSN.ca) - Dr. Alan Bernstein, President of the Canadian Institutes for Health Research (CIHR) is to appear before the House Health Committee Wednesday. At the meeting he will likely be asked to account for his presentation of the funding guidelines on stem cell research prior to legislation on the matter being presented in Parliament. Rob Merrifield, Official Opposition Senior Health Critic called for Berstein to appear before the committee last month saying, "Dr. Bernstein needs to explain why the CIHR pre-empted Parliament."

James Lunney, another Alliance Health Critic, expressed outrage at the CIHR guidelines which permit funding of the destruction of human embryos for research purposes. "Will the Minister overturn this act of Parliamentary Piracy and bring in legislation post-haste?" Lunney asked in the House of Commons following the CIHR release.

While the government plans to table legislation on or before May 10, Health Minister Anne McLellan said the legislation would closely follow the CIHR guidelines. Lunney blasted the collusion between the CIHR and McLellan. "If this hijacking is allowed to proceed why should anyone bother to appear before a Parliamentary Committee? Why should Committee waste months of hearings to make informed recommendations only to be ignored? Proceeding in this manner makes the process a fraud, a sham and a waste of taxpayers' money. The Chretien Government ought to be ashamed!" said Lunney.
